Posted Jun 8, 2019
Works on MacOS 10.14 Mojave!
Connect and choose "USB Advanced Audio Device," then "Encoded Digital Audio" for AC3 output from iTunes. No apparent Safari (Plex, etc.) support, YET.

Response from Staples :
We only officially support the ICUSBAUDIO2D up to Mac OS 10.8 currently, since functionality is limited on later versions
